struct VideoEncodeH264PictureInfoKHR

Defined at line 128749 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

Public Members

StructureType sType
const void * pNext
uint32_t naluSliceEntryCount
const vk::VideoEncodeH264NaluSliceInfoKHR * pNaluSliceEntries
const StdVideoEncodeH264PictureInfo * pStdPictureInfo
vk::Bool32 generatePrefixNalu

Public Methods

void VideoEncodeH264PictureInfoKHR (uint32_t naluSliceEntryCount_, const vk::VideoEncodeH264NaluSliceInfoKHR * pNaluSliceEntries_, const StdVideoEncodeH264PictureInfo * pStdPictureInfo_, vk::Bool32 generatePrefixNalu_, const void * pNext_)

Defined at line 128757 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

void VideoEncodeH264PictureInfoKHR (const VideoEncodeH264PictureInfoKHR & rhs)

Defined at line 128770 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

void VideoEncodeH264PictureInfoKHR (const VkVideoEncodeH264PictureInfoKHR & rhs)

Defined at line 128772 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

void VideoEncodeH264PictureInfoKHR (const vk::ArrayProxyNoTemporaries<const vk::VideoEncodeH264NaluSliceInfoKHR> & naluSliceEntries_, const StdVideoEncodeH264PictureInfo * pStdPictureInfo_, vk::Bool32 generatePrefixNalu_, const void * pNext_)

Defined at line 128778 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

VideoEncodeH264PictureInfoKHR & operator= (const VideoEncodeH264PictureInfoKHR & rhs)

Defined at line 128792 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

VideoEncodeH264PictureInfoKHR & operator= (const VkVideoEncodeH264PictureInfoKHR & rhs)

Defined at line 128795 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

VideoEncodeH264PictureInfoKHR & setPNext (const void * pNext_)

Defined at line 128802 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

VideoEncodeH264PictureInfoKHR & setNaluSliceEntryCount (uint32_t naluSliceEntryCount_)

Defined at line 128808 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

VideoEncodeH264PictureInfoKHR & setPNaluSliceEntries (const vk::VideoEncodeH264NaluSliceInfoKHR * pNaluSliceEntries_)

Defined at line 128814 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

VideoEncodeH264PictureInfoKHR & setNaluSliceEntries (const vk::ArrayProxyNoTemporaries<const vk::VideoEncodeH264NaluSliceInfoKHR> & naluSliceEntries_)

Defined at line 128822 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

VideoEncodeH264PictureInfoKHR & setPStdPictureInfo (const StdVideoEncodeH264PictureInfo * pStdPictureInfo_)

Defined at line 128831 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

VideoEncodeH264PictureInfoKHR & setGeneratePrefixNalu (vk::Bool32 generatePrefixNalu_)

Defined at line 128837 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

const VkVideoEncodeH264PictureInfoKHR & operator const VkVideoEncodeH264PictureInfoKHR & ()

Defined at line 128844 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

VkVideoEncodeH264PictureInfoKHR & operator VkVideoEncodeH264PictureInfoKHR & ()

Defined at line 128849 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p

std::strong_ordering operator<=> (const VideoEncodeH264PictureInfoKHR & )

Defined at line 128872 of file ../../third_party/Vulkan-Headers/src/include/vulkan/vulkan_structs.hpp